Generative Analysis: The Power of Generative AI for Object-Oriented Software Engineering with UML

Arlow, Jim, Neustadt, Ila

  • 出版商: Addison Wesley
  • 出版日期: 2024-10-11
  • 售價: $2,470
  • 貴賓價: 9.5$2,347
  • 語言: 英文
  • 頁數: 688
  • 裝訂: Quality Paper - also called trade paper
  • ISBN: 013829142X
  • ISBN-13: 9780138291426
  • 相關分類: UML人工智慧Object-oriented軟體工程
  • 海外代購書籍(需單獨結帳)

相關主題

商品描述

Learn Generative Analysis--a New Method of Object-Oriented Analysis--to Keep Pace with How Generative AI Is Transforming the Face of Software Engineering

Generative AI is revolutionizing software engineering--many aspects of manual coding are becoming automated, and the skills needed by software engineers, developers, and analysts are evolving. Anyone who writes or works with code will need to produce precise analysis artifacts to feed the AI code-generation process. Enter generative analysis: a precise, structured way for software engineers, programmers, and analysts to transition to this new, AI-enhanced software engineering world.

In Generative Analysis, experts Jim Arlow and Ila Neustadt leverage Literate Modeling, M++, and multivalent logic to lay out a step-by-step approach to object-oriented analysis that produces clear and unambiguous results suitable for further processing into code by generative AI systems such as Copilot, ChatGPT, and Gemini. Prepare for the challenge of the future by understanding the flexibility you already have at hand using generative analysis.

  • Gain a new perspective on the shift to generative AI-based programming models
  • Understand how generative analysis artifacts feed generative AIs to generate code and UML models
  • Explore techniques that feed into and refine each other until a precise analysis definition of a software system is achieved
  • Recognize milestones and end points to eliminate "analysis paralysis"
  • Learn to work at the right level of abstraction to leverage the most power from generative AI
  • Gain understanding from real-world, detailed examples of prompts and AI responses

This guide teaches advanced, precise, and sophisticated analysis techniques that will allow you to thrive in the new world of software engineering with generative AI.

Register your book for convenient access to downloads, updates, and/or corrections as they become available. See inside book for details.

商品描述(中文翻譯)

學習《生成分析》——一種新的物件導向分析方法——以跟上生成式 AI 如何改變軟體工程的面貌

生成式 AI 正在徹底改變軟體工程——許多手動編碼的方面正在自動化,軟體工程師、開發人員和分析師所需的技能也在不斷演變。任何撰寫或處理程式碼的人都需要產出精確的分析文檔,以供 AI 代碼生成過程使用。這就是生成分析的出現:一種精確、結構化的方法,幫助軟體工程師、程式設計師和分析師過渡到這個新的、增強 AI 的軟體工程世界。

在《生成分析》中,專家 Jim Arlow 和 Ila Neustadt 利用文學建模、M++ 和多元邏輯,提出了一種逐步的方法來進行物件導向分析,產出清晰且不含歧義的結果,適合進一步由生成式 AI 系統(如 Copilot、ChatGPT 和 Gemini)處理成代碼。通過理解您已經掌握的靈活性,為未來的挑戰做好準備,使用生成分析。

- 獲得對生成式 AI 基礎編程模型轉變的新視角
- 理解生成分析文檔如何為生成式 AI 提供資料以生成代碼和 UML 模型
- 探索相互促進和精煉的技術,直到達成軟體系統的精確分析定義
- 辨識里程碑和終點,以消除「分析癱瘓」
- 學會在適當的抽象層次上工作,以充分利用生成式 AI 的力量
- 從現實世界的詳細範例中獲得理解,包括提示和 AI 回應

本指南教授先進、精確且複雜的分析技術,將使您在生成式 AI 的新軟體工程世界中蓬勃發展。

註冊您的書籍,以便方便地訪問下載、更新和/或修正,隨著它們的可用性而提供。詳情請參見書內。